Hand-signed, numbered // Anni Albers' 'ST' is a 1971 screen-print that exemplifies her minimalist and geometric style, rooted in the Bauhaus tradition. This piece features a subtle, repetitive pattern of abstract leaf-like shapes, arranged in a grid that creates a sense of rhythm and harmony. The delicate use of white and very pale tones on a soft background allows the pattern to appear almost translucent, blending into the surrounding space and encouraging a quiet, contemplative interaction with the viewer. Albers' mastery of form and repetition reflects her deep understanding of textiles and design, offering a serene balance between structure and fluidity in this minimalist work.

What is Hard Edge Art?
Hard Edge art is a style of abstract painting that became popular in the 1960s. It features areas of color separated by crisp, sharp edges that are painted with geometric precision. The term hard-edge painting was coined by art critic Jules Langsner to describe this approach, which contrasts with the softer, more fluid forms of other abstract styles.
